[ARM] Enable shrink-wrapping by default.
[oota-llvm.git] / test / CodeGen / ARM / darwin-eabi.ll
index f0696b3bd0584f8137ef659989cfb7d835d09d8f..5301c0b38a750014385db20e6bc25749576efe18 100644 (file)
@@ -1,11 +1,13 @@
 ; RUN: llc -mtriple=thumbv7m-apple-darwin -mcpu=cortex-m3 < %s | FileCheck %s --check-prefix=CHECK-M3
 ; RUN: llc -mtriple=thumbv7em-apple-darwin -mcpu=cortex-m4 < %s | FileCheck %s --check-prefix=CHECK-M4
+; RUN: llc -mtriple=thumbv7-apple-darwin -mcpu=cortex-m3 < %s | FileCheck %s --check-prefix=CHECK-M3
+; RUN: llc -mtriple=thumbv7-apple-darwin -mcpu=cortex-m4 < %s | FileCheck %s --check-prefix=CHECK-M4
 
 define float @float_op(float %lhs, float %rhs) {
   %sum = fadd float %lhs, %rhs
   ret float %sum
 ; CHECK-M3-LABEL: float_op:
-; CHECK-M3: blx ___addsf3
+; CHECK-M3: bl ___addsf3
 
 ; CHECK-M4-LABEL: float_op:
 ; CHECK-M4: vadd.f32
@@ -15,8 +17,8 @@ define double @double_op(double %lhs, double %rhs) {
   %sum = fadd double %lhs, %rhs
   ret double %sum
 ; CHECK-M3-LABEL: double_op:
-; CHECK-M3: blx ___adddf3
+; CHECK-M3: bl ___adddf3
 
 ; CHECK-M4-LABEL: double_op:
-; CHECK-M4: blx ___adddf3
+; CHECK-M4: {{(blx|b.w)}} ___adddf3
 }